Output 21e58875c5b73b5c36f161db85471929c93822cbb70c00e57600e3e2d53c7de8:0

value
27214100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dff76633c37f6a8e07551643b5423e753935596 OP_EQUAL
address
3BidcJ6cogm8etXC2doM6RJa9NCYfAPg4o
transaction
21e58875c5b73b5c36f161db85471929c93822cbb70c00e57600e3e2d53c7de8